You can try a tube of Vinyl Weld.(Not sure if its evo stick or loctite these days) I used to see it in all the DIY shops but for some reason I couldn't see any the last few times I've been in.
It may or may not work, but is worth a try. I used it effectively on the rear screen of a sportscar hood which developed a small crack.
I reckon it will work . I had a tear in a "window" in a tent , went to local camping shop who supplied spare transparent vinyl and adhesive .Worked a treat .
Hi, I used some of this clear polythene all-weather tape to repair some holes in a tarpauline, after 6 months it was still well stuck, and in better nick than the rest of the tarp. I think it would be good reinforcement to a glued repair.
